Cost-Effective Sourcing: Buying 1,1,3,3-Tetramethoxypropane from China
In today's competitive global market, procurement professionals are constantly seeking ways to optimize costs without compromising on quality. For businesses that rely on 1,1,3,3-Tetramethoxypropane (CAS 102-52-3) for their manufacturing processes, understanding how to source this fine chemical intermediate effectively can lead to significant savings. This guide focuses on the advantages of buying 1,1,3,3-Tetramethoxypropane from Chinese manufacturers and suppliers.
1,1,3,3-Tetramethoxypropane is a critical building block in various industrial applications, most notably in the synthesis of pharmaceutical intermediates and dyes. Its consistent demand across these sectors means that securing a stable and cost-effective supply is essential for operational continuity. While numerous chemical suppliers exist globally, China has established itself as a powerhouse in the production of a wide array of fine chemicals, including acetals like 1,1,3,3-Tetramethoxypropane.

Logistics and shipping are also key considerations. Chinese suppliers have well-developed export infrastructure, enabling efficient transportation via sea, air, or land. They are experienced in handling international shipments and customs procedures, which can streamline the procurement process. Understanding the incoterms (e.g., FOB, CFR, CIF) and associated shipping costs is vital when comparing offers from different suppliers.
When initiating contact with potential suppliers, clearly stating your requirements is crucial. This includes the CAS number (102-52-3), desired quantity, purity specification (e.g., ≥98%), packaging preferences, and delivery timeline. A prompt and detailed response, along with competitive pricing, can be indicative of a reliable partner. For businesses that have previously purchased this intermediate, recommendations from industry peers can also be invaluable in identifying trustworthy manufacturers.
